Great to see pride rainbow in Riverside
Opinion: Letters to the editor
How great to see the rainbow pride flag flying in Guthrie Park this week! Nearby towns like Berwyn and Oak Park have rainbow flags flying from their village halls, and I'm so glad to see it here.
Thanks to the Riverside residents in the group Action for a Better Tomorrow for creating and posting a visual statement of inclusion and support here in Riverside. It's one more way to show Riverside is a welcoming community, one that's appreciative and respectful of all our citizens
